Roskilde Festival, Northern Europe’s largest festival, today unveils the first acts confirmed for the music programme at the festival’s 50th edition, which will now take place next year, from 26th June – 3rd July 2021.
Festival-goers at the 50th edition of the Danish non-profit festival can look forward to experiencing the ever-experimental multi-talent TYLER, THE CREATOR on the Orange Stage, and British artist FKA TWIGS will bring her sonic adventurousness, underlining why she’s one of the most important voices of her generation right now. Both acts were in the lineup this year, and like THOM YORKE TOMORROW’S MODERN BOXES, they will be re-booked for Roskilde Festival 2021.
In addition, R&B icons TLC will play at the festival. In the 90s, they conquered the charts with singles like ‘Waterfalls’ and ‘No Scrubs’, and in 2021 they will play their first concert in Denmark. THE WHITEST BOY ALIVE, fronted by the charismatic Norwegian Erlend Øye, will also be a part of the programme when they play their only Scandinavian concert at Roskilde Festival in 2021.
Today’s announcement also includes two music acts who were not on the poster this year. Norwegian black metal pioneers in MAYHEM will arrive at Roskilde Festival with the album ‘Daemon’ from 2019. The group helped define the black metal genre in the late 80s and early 90s.
Also new on the bill is English super producer FLOATING POINTS. Behind the name is the critically acclaimed electronic composer Sam Shepherd. He visits Roskilde Festival 2021 with a late-night concert where anything can happen.

For us it has been important to invite some of the acts back whom we believe will be both significant and top-notch next year. Tyler, The Creator and FKA twigs are two central players because they are two younger artists who are constantly working with their own sound and renewing the concert format. Their concerts always bring about new experiences.
Anders Wahrén – Roskilde Festival head of programme
The music programme at Roskilde Festival 2021 will not mirror the festival that should have been because we cannot and will not copy the full programme. Right now, there is a pandemic and racism is on the global agenda. Historically, big agendas also make their way into the arts, which is why, of course, we keep part of the programme open to bring new, relevant names into play.
